ABSTRACT:
An engine preheating system comprising a pair of oppositely disposed burner devices operated by propane gas, a pair of oppositely disposed cylindrical combustion chambers with a cylindrical coolant jacket therearound, and a central cylindrical stack connected to the combustion chambers with a coolant jacket therearound connected to the other coolant jacket.
